United Transpacific flight San Francisco to seoul

United Airlines resumed daily nonstop flight to Seoul from San Francisco.
"This nonstop service meets our customers' increasing demand for convenient service between South Korea and the United States "It is also part of our expansion in Asia. With the number of flights we offer and destinations served, our Asia service accounts for 25 percent of United's capacity."
United will operate the SFO ICN service with a Boeing 777 aircraft that seats 253 passengers: 10 in United First®, 45 in United Business® and 198 in United Economy®, including more than 80 Economy Plus® seats.

United now operates more than 400 flights a week to/from or within the region -- including service to Bangkok, Beijing, Ho Chi Minh City, Hong Kong, Melbourne, Nagoya, Osaka, Seoul, Shanghai, Singapore, Sydney, Taipei and Tokyo. The airline has more than 2,500 employees based in the region. United operates two flight attendant bases in Tokyo and Hong Kong with almost 1,000 flight attendants based in the region. United was named “Best Transpacific Airline” in the 2005 OAG Airline of the Year Awards, “Best North American Airline” by Business Traveller Asia Pacific and TTG Asia in 2005 and “Best American Airline serving China” in the inaugural Business Traveller China travel poll.
